During international trade and shipping, cargo can face a range of risks due to long distances, varying climatic conditions, and multiple handling points. Incidents such as accidents, fire, theft, flooding, or packaging damage can lead to serious financial losses. For this reason, cargo insurance is an integral part of international trade. Types of Cargo Insurance
Cargo insurance is a type of policy arranged to protect shipments from loss and damage. Three primary insurance clauses exist based on scope and risk level, each covering a different group of risks.
Core Insurance Clause Options
- Clause A (Broadest Coverage): Covers almost all risks; recommended for high-value cargo
- Clause B (Intermediate Coverage): Covers named risks such as fire, earthquake, seawater ingress, and vehicle collision
- Clause C (Restricted Coverage): Covers only major incidents such as vehicle overturning, collision, and flooding
- ADR Additional Insurance: Specific risk coverage for the transport of hazardous materials
- War and Strikes Clause: Covers losses arising from political risks and civil unrest

Determining the Insured Value
In cargo insurance, the insured value is calculated on the CIF value of the goods. CIF represents the sum of the cost of goods, insurance premium, and freight costs. In some cases, the expected profit on the cargo may also be included in the insured value. Failing to determine the correct insured value creates a risk of under-indemnification.
